What Is a Template Website?
A template website is built using a pre-designed layout. Platforms such as website builders and CMS themes provide ready-made templates that businesses can customize with their content, images, and branding.

Advantages of Template Websites
✅ Lower initial cost
✅ Faster launch time
✅ Easy to manage
✅ Suitable for startups and small businesses
Disadvantages of Template Websites
❌ Limited customization
❌ Generic design shared by many websites
❌ Potential performance issues
❌ Limited scalability
❌ SEO limitations in some cases
What Is a Custom Website?
A custom website is designed and developed specifically for your business requirements. Every feature, design element, and user experience component is built from scratch to align with your brand and goals.
Advantages of Custom Websites
✅ Unique and professional appearance
✅ Better user experience
✅ Higher performance and speed
✅ Advanced SEO capabilities
✅ Improved security
✅ Scalable for future growth
Disadvantages of Custom Websites
❌ Higher upfront investment
❌ Longer development timeline
❌ Requires professional expertise

Which Option Is Better for SEO?
Search engines prioritize websites that offer:
- Fast loading speed
- Mobile responsiveness
- Clean code structure
- Excellent user experience
- Unique content
Custom websites often perform better because developers can optimize every aspect of the site specifically for search engines.
A custom-built website allows businesses to create:
- Optimized page structures
- Custom schema markup
- Better Core Web Vitals
- Advanced technical SEO implementation
This can result in higher rankings and increased organic traffic.

When Should You Choose a Template Website?
A template website may be the right choice if:
- You’re launching a new business.
- You have a limited budget.
- You need a website quickly.
- Your website requirements are simple.
When Should You Choose a Custom Website?
A custom website is ideal if:
- You want a unique brand identity.
- You plan to grow your business online.
- SEO is a major priority.
- You need advanced features or integrations.
- You want maximum flexibility and scalability.
